The court recommended denying the plaintiff's motion for default judgment against defendants for failing to answer the complaint, as the Prison Litigation Reform Act prohibits default relief in prisoner § 1983 cases unless the court first orders defendants to respond and finds plaintiff has a reasonable opportunity to prevail on the merits.
